如何训练AI语音对话模型以实现高效沟通
在一个繁忙的都市中,张明是一家初创科技公司的CEO。他的公司致力于研发人工智能技术,其中一项重要项目就是打造一个能够实现高效沟通的AI语音对话模型。张明深知,在这个信息爆炸的时代,人们对于沟通效率的要求越来越高,而AI语音对话模型有望成为未来沟通的重要工具。
张明深知,要训练出一个高效的AI语音对话模型,并非易事。他开始从以下几个方面着手,逐步实现这一目标。
一、数据收集与处理
首先,张明和他的团队开始着手收集大量的语音数据。这些数据包括不同口音、语速、语调的语音样本,以及各种场景下的对话内容。为了确保数据的多样性,他们甚至从互联网上购买了大量的语音库,并从中筛选出符合要求的样本。
在收集到大量数据后,团队对数据进行预处理,包括去除噪声、静音、剪辑多余部分等。此外,为了提高模型的学习效果,他们还采用了一些数据增强技术,如时间变换、频率变换、声谱变换等,以丰富模型的学习样本。
二、模型设计与优化
在模型设计方面,张明和他的团队选择了目前较为先进的深度学习技术——循环神经网络(RNN)及其变体长短期记忆网络(LSTM)和门控循环单元(GRU)。这些模型在处理序列数据方面具有优势,能够有效捕捉语音中的时序信息。
然而,在实际应用中,这些模型存在一些问题,如梯度消失、梯度爆炸等。为了解决这些问题,张明团队对模型进行了优化。他们尝试了多种优化方法,如梯度裁剪、权重正则化、批归一化等,以提高模型的稳定性和收敛速度。
在模型结构方面,他们还引入了注意力机制,使模型能够关注对话中的关键信息,提高对话的准确性和流畅性。此外,为了提高模型的泛化能力,他们还采用了迁移学习技术,将预训练的模型在特定任务上进行微调。
三、训练与评估
在模型训练过程中,张明团队采用了多种训练策略。首先,他们采用了多任务学习,使模型在多个任务上同时进行训练,以提高模型的综合能力。其次,他们采用了数据增强技术,以增加模型的学习样本。最后,他们采用了分布式训练,以提高训练速度。
在模型评估方面,张明团队采用了多种评估指标,如准确率、召回率、F1值等。他们还在实际应用场景中进行了测试,以验证模型的实际效果。
四、应用与改进
在模型训练完成后,张明团队将其应用于实际场景,如智能客服、智能家居等。在实际应用中,他们发现模型在处理某些特定场景时,仍存在一些问题。为此,他们开始对模型进行改进。
首先,他们针对特定场景,对模型进行定制化调整。例如,在智能客服场景中,他们优化了模型对常见问题的回答能力。其次,他们引入了多轮对话策略,使模型能够更好地理解用户意图,并给出合适的回答。
此外,张明团队还关注了模型的可解释性。他们希望用户能够了解模型的决策过程,从而提高用户对AI语音对话模型的信任度。为此,他们采用了一些可解释性技术,如注意力可视化、梯度可视化等。
五、未来展望
随着人工智能技术的不断发展,AI语音对话模型将具有更广泛的应用前景。张明和他的团队将继续努力,不断优化模型,提高其性能。以下是他们的一些未来展望:
跨语言支持:随着全球化的推进,跨语言沟通需求日益增长。张明团队计划在未来实现模型对多种语言的识别和翻译功能。
情感识别:在对话过程中,情感因素对沟通效果具有重要影响。张明团队计划在模型中引入情感识别功能,以更好地理解用户情绪。
个性化推荐:根据用户的兴趣和需求,模型可以为用户提供个性化的服务。张明团队计划实现这一功能,以提升用户体验。
跨领域应用:AI语音对话模型在各个领域都有广泛的应用前景。张明团队计划将模型应用于更多领域,如医疗、教育、金融等。
总之,张明和他的团队在训练AI语音对话模型方面取得了显著成果。他们将继续努力,为用户提供更高效、便捷的沟通体验。在这个充满挑战和机遇的时代,他们相信,AI语音对话模型将成为未来沟通的重要工具。
猜你喜欢:AI翻译